"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"src/src.pro" between
MP3Diags-unstable-1.3.04.tar.gz and MP3Diags-unstable-1.5.01.tar.gz

About: MP3 Diags finds problems in MP3 files and helps the user to fix many of them (with a GUI). Also includes a tag editor and a file renamer.

src.pro  (MP3Diags-unstable-1.3.04):src.pro  (MP3Diags-unstable-1.5.01)
skipping to change at line 72 skipping to change at line 72
CbException.cpp CbException.cpp
TEMPLATE = app TEMPLATE = app
CONFIG += warn_on \ CONFIG += warn_on \
thread \ thread \
qt \ qt \
debug_and_release debug_and_release
TARGET = MP3Diags-unstable TARGET = MP3Diags-unstable
DESTDIR = ../bin DESTDIR = ../bin
QT += xml \ QT += xml \
network network \
widgets
RESOURCES += Mp3Diags.qrc RESOURCES += Mp3Diags.qrc
HEADERS += AboutDlgImpl.h \ HEADERS += AboutDlgImpl.h \
AlbumInfoDownloaderDlgImpl.h \ AlbumInfoDownloaderDlgImpl.h \
ApeStream.h \ ApeStream.h \
CheckedDir.h \ CheckedDir.h \
ColumnResizer.h \ ColumnResizer.h \
CommonData.h \ CommonData.h \
CommonTypes.h \ CommonTypes.h \
skipping to change at line 136 skipping to change at line 137
TagWriter.h \ TagWriter.h \
ThreadRunnerDlgImpl.h \ ThreadRunnerDlgImpl.h \
Transformation.h \ Transformation.h \
UniqueNotesModel.h \ UniqueNotesModel.h \
Widgets.h \ Widgets.h \
fstream_unicode.h \ fstream_unicode.h \
ExportDlgImpl.h \ ExportDlgImpl.h \
FullSizeImgDlg.h \ FullSizeImgDlg.h \
Version.h \ Version.h \
Translation.h \ Translation.h \
CbException.h CbException.h \
QHttp \
QHttpRequestHeader \
QHttpResponseHeader
FORMS += About.ui \ FORMS += About.ui \
AlbumInfoDownloader.ui \ AlbumInfoDownloader.ui \
Config.ui \ Config.ui \
Debug.ui \ Debug.ui \
DirFilter.ui \ DirFilter.ui \
DoubleListWdg.ui \ DoubleListWdg.ui \
FileRenamer.ui \ FileRenamer.ui \
ImageInfoPanel.ui \ ImageInfoPanel.ui \
MainForm.ui \ MainForm.ui \
ExternalTool.ui \ ExternalTool.ui \
skipping to change at line 163 skipping to change at line 168
TagEditor.ui \ TagEditor.ui \
ThreadRunner.ui \ ThreadRunner.ui \
Export.ui Export.ui
UI_DIR = ui-forms UI_DIR = ui-forms
#CONFIG += console #CONFIG += console
# !!! One thing to keep in mind is that when using BuildMp3Diags.hta the file sr c.pro shouldn't be changed. At the first build attempt a copy src.pro1 is create d in the "package" dir, and that is where changes for the actual location of the libs # !!! One thing to keep in mind is that when using BuildMp3Diags.hta the file sr c.pro shouldn't be changed. At the first build attempt a copy src.pro1 is create d in the "package" dir, and that is where changes for the actual location of the libs
QMAKE_CXXFLAGS_DEBUG += -DOUTPUT_TRACE_TO_CONSOLE QMAKE_CXXFLAGS_DEBUG += -DOUTPUT_TRACE_TO_CONSOLE -Wno-unused-parameter -Wno-dep recated-declarations -Wno-zero-as-null-pointer-constant -Wno-sign-conversion -Wn o-weak-vtables -Wno-sign-conversion
#DEFINES += DISABLE_CHECK_FOR_UPDATES #DEFINES += DISABLE_CHECK_FOR_UPDATES
#DEFINES += OS2 #DEFINES += OS2
# GENERATE_TOC and GAPLESS_SUPPORT are not independent (though perhaps they shou ld be), so GAPLESS_SUPPORT is ignored if GENERATE_TOC is set # GENERATE_TOC and GAPLESS_SUPPORT are not independent (though perhaps they shou ld be), so GAPLESS_SUPPORT is ignored if GENERATE_TOC is set
# GAPLESS_SUPPORT also need LAME library # GAPLESS_SUPPORT also need LAME library
#QMAKE_CXXFLAGS_DEBUG += -DGENERATE_TOC #QMAKE_CXXFLAGS_DEBUG += -DGENERATE_TOC
#QMAKE_CXXFLAGS_DEBUG += -DGAPLESS_SUPPORT #QMAKE_CXXFLAGS_DEBUG += -DGAPLESS_SUPPORT
#QMAKE_CXXFLAGS += -DGAPLESS_SUPPORT #QMAKE_CXXFLAGS += -DGAPLESS_SUPPORT
LIBS += -lz \ LIBS += -lz \
-lboost_serialization-mt \ -lboost_serialization\
-lboost_program_options-mt -lboost_program_options
#LIBS += -lmp3lame #LIBS += -lmp3lame
# Notes for Windows gapless support: # Notes for Windows gapless support:
# - It's hard to build Lame and prebuilt libs are not official and don't work: # - It's hard to build Lame and prebuilt libs are not official and don't work:
# - they don't have the apparently newer hip_decode_init(), but only the o lder lame_decode_init(), which seems to have been deprecated in 2004 # - they don't have the apparently newer hip_decode_init(), but only the o lder lame_decode_init(), which seems to have been deprecated in 2004
# - there were different library names, like lame_enc.dll # - there were different library names, like lame_enc.dll
# - it is supposedly possible to build an .a and then convert it to a .dll # - it is supposedly possible to build an .a and then convert it to a .dll
# - older installed MinGW cannot compile LAME; there is an addon MSYS / RX VT, which adds "make" and a few other things and thus allows building, but it's probably hard to get for the older version which came with the Qt used for build ing # - older installed MinGW cannot compile LAME; there is an addon MSYS / RX VT, which adds "make" and a few other things and thus allows building, but it's probably hard to get for the older version which came with the Qt used for build ing
# - DLLs built with MSVC allow the MinGW built exe to start, but trying to use LAME causes a crash # - DLLs built with MSVC allow the MinGW built exe to start, but trying to use LAME causes a crash
 End of changes. 4 change blocks. 
5 lines changed or deleted 10 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)